Broadband Access Policies Shape Rural American Communities
Rural American communities face significant challenges in accessing reliable high-speed internet, with broadband policies playing a crucial role in determining their economic and social development. Federal and state initiatives continue to address the digital divide through infrastructure investments, regulatory frameworks, and public-private partnerships that aim to bring modern connectivity to underserved areas.
The digital divide between urban and rural America remains a defining challenge of the 21st century, with broadband access policies serving as the primary mechanism for bridging this gap. Rural communities across the United States continue to struggle with limited internet infrastructure, affecting everything from educational opportunities to economic growth and healthcare access.

Internet Trends Shaping Rural Policy Development
Current internet trends significantly influence rural broadband policy development. The growing demand for streaming services, remote work capabilities, and telehealth applications has highlighted the inadequacy of existing rural internet infrastructure. Policy makers are responding to these trends by updating broadband speed requirements and expanding funding for rural internet projects.
The trend toward Internet of Things applications in agriculture has also influenced policy discussions, with rural broadband policies increasingly considering the needs of precision farming and agricultural technology that requires reliable internet connectivity.
Telecommunication Advancements in Rural Infrastructure
Telecommunication advancements continue to reshape possibilities for rural internet access. 5G technology deployment, low-Earth orbit satellite networks, and improved fiber-optic installation techniques are creating new opportunities for rural connectivity. These technological advances are being incorporated into federal and state broadband policies through updated funding criteria and infrastructure requirements.
Fixed wireless technology has emerged as a particularly promising solution for rural areas, offering faster deployment than traditional fiber-optic cables while providing significantly better performance than older satellite internet options.
| Provider Type | Technology | Coverage Area | Speed Range | Monthly Cost |
|---|---|---|---|---|
| Satellite Internet | Low-Earth Orbit | Nationwide | 25-100 Mbps | $50-150 |
| Fixed Wireless | Cellular/Radio | Regional | 10-50 Mbps | $40-100 |
| Fiber Internet | Fiber-Optic | Limited Rural | 100+ Mbps | $60-120 |
| DSL Service | Phone Lines | Widespread | 5-25 Mbps | $30-70 |
